Factors to Consider When Choosing a Cellular Security Camera for Farm
When you’re choosing a cellular security camera for your farm, several key factors come into play. You’ll want to think about connectivity options, power supply, and camera resolution to guarantee peak performance. Additionally, consider durability, weatherproofing, and motion detection features to keep your property safe year-round.
Connectivity Options Available
Choosing the right connectivity options for your cellular security camera is vital, especially since remote farm locations can pose unique challenges. Verify your camera is compatible with major 4G LTE networks like Verizon, AT&T, and T-Mobile for reliable connectivity. Opt for models that include a pre-installed SIM card and offer a trial data plan, allowing you to test the connection before committing to a subscription. It’s important to check if each camera requires its own data plan, as this can impact your overall costs. Look for devices that connect to the strongest available network automatically to guarantee uninterrupted service. Finally, confirm that the camera functions in your specific location, as some may not work outside their designated country.
Power Supply Considerations
Reliable connectivity is just one piece of the puzzle when selecting a cellular security camera for your farm. You should consider solar power options with high-capacity batteries, guaranteeing continuous operation without an external power source. Look for cameras equipped with efficient solar panels that can recharge batteries, providing uninterrupted functionality throughout the year. Opt for models boasting long battery life, ideally designed to run for 365 days on solar energy alone, minimizing maintenance efforts. Additionally, confirm the camera has a weatherproof rating of IP65 or higher to withstand harsh conditions like rain, dust, and extreme temperatures. Finally, check for easy setup and installation, especially in remote areas where traditional power supply isn’t available, enhancing your monitoring flexibility.
Camera Resolution Quality
Image clarity is essential for effective surveillance on your farm, making camera resolution quality a key factor in your selection process. Generally measured in megapixels (MP), higher MP values provide clearer images, vital for identifying faces or license plates. A resolution of 2K (around 2560 x 1440 pixels) strikes a balance between clarity and storage efficiency, making it suitable for various monitoring tasks. Additionally, consider cameras with color night vision capabilities, as they enhance visibility in low light, allowing for better identification compared to standard black-and-white options. Features like 4X digital zoom can also be beneficial, enabling you to focus on specific areas without losing image quality, ensuring you get the most out of your surveillance efforts.
Durability and Weatherproofing
When it comes to securing your farm, durability and weatherproofing are just as important as camera resolution. Look for a weatherproof rating of at least IP65 to protect against dust and water in harsh outdoor conditions. Guarantee the camera’s housing is made from durable materials like high-quality ABS, which can withstand extreme temperatures and impacts. Cameras with high-capacity solar panels offer continuous power, making them ideal for remote areas without electricity. Assess how well the camera performs in various weather conditions, including rain, snow, heat, and cold, to guarantee reliability year-round. Finally, choose models with robust designs that feature flame resistance and UV protection to enhance longevity and functionality in outdoor settings.
Motion Detection Features
How can you guarantee that your cellular security camera effectively captures only the relevant movements on your farm? Look for cameras equipped with advanced PIR (Passive Infrared) motion sensors that detect heat and movement, minimizing false alerts from pets or swaying branches. Customizable detection zones let you specify areas to monitor, ensuring alerts only trigger for movement in those spaces. Real-time alerts sent to your mobile device keep you informed of detected motion, enabling quick responses to potential threats. Some cameras even feature AI human recognition technology, enhancing accuracy by differentiating between humans and other movements. Additionally, integrated two-way audio functionality allows you to communicate directly through the camera, adding an interactive layer during motion events.
Subscription Plans and Costs
Choosing the right subscription plan for your cellular security camera can greatly impact your farm’s security budget. Most cameras require a plan after an initial trial, with costs ranging from about $19.90 per month to $169.90 per year per device. If you deploy multiple cameras, these costs can quickly add up, as each one typically needs its own data plan. Many cameras come with a pre-installed SIM card offering a 7-day trial of unlimited data, so you can test connectivity before committing. Be mindful of the plan’s features; some include cloud storage for footage, which might incur extra charges after the trial. Review data limits carefully, as exceeding them can lead to additional costs.
